As for HPLC, the pump provides the cellular section at a managed stream price(a). Air can certainly dissolve within the cellular stage under the conventional atmospheric strain through which we are now living in. Should the cellular stage incorporates air bubbles and enters the shipping pump, troubles for instance circulation amount fluctuations and baseline sound/drift could arise. The degassing unit helps prevent this situation by eradicating air bubbles within the cell period(b). After the dissolved air has actually been eliminated, the cellular section is delivered to the column.

HPLC is undoubtedly an abbreviation for High Performance Liquid Chromatography. "Chromatography" is often a technique for separation, "chromatogram" is the result of chromatography, and "chromatograph" could be the instrument used to perform chromatography.
There are some modes of chromatography that are hard to render eco-friendly. By way of example, HILIC separations are commonly very best reached using higher proportions of acetonitrile from the mobile section. Although not favored from a sustainability standpoint, effective substitution for acetonitrile has long been elusive.
